Rheumatoid Arthritis Support Group
Rheumatoid arthritis is a chronic, inflammatory, multisystem, autoimmune disorder. It is a disabling and painful condition which can lead to substantial loss of mobility due to pain and joint destruction. The disease is also systemic in that it often also affects many extra-articular tissues throughout the body including the skin, blood vessels, heart, lungs, and...

But I have in the past and she just shrugs. i think the reason is that fatigue can be attributable to a whole lot of shit. getting older? another co-morbidity? the ra is flaring? the current pharma regime you are on is stale? you just finished a pred taper? you are fighting with your spouse? the kids college loans are too over the top? the dog was whining all night? your blood pressure sucks? you are borderline sugar? did she really say absolutely no connection her words? fatigue is part of inflammation - does your rheum consider your inflammation markers to be stable? (blood work you know esr crp rf yadda yadda) - and are your joints looking red and hot and inflammed or pretty good?
I also go with function. When I can't do the activities of daily life then my fatigue sucks and my joints are huge. What about you? are you keeping up?
